Im a pretty big fan of Shonen and an even bigger fan of Comedy Saiki K and Grand Blue Dreaming are some of my favourites so please bear that in mind when reading this review as I believe the merits of Mashle depend heavily on the audience. For me Mashle was a honestly brilliant show. With only 12 episodes Mashle doesnt dive too deep into any of its characters however I honestly think thats alright because it does a perfect job of introducing their comedicrelevant quirks and establishing interesting and fun dynamics within the cast. With the exception of Lemon and Finn who are a little weaker Mashle really does make you invest and care about Mash Lance and my personal favourite the main character Dot. The comedy can be hitormiss however if youre a fan of slapstick humour or enjoy 4koma manga which Mashle isnt but reminds me of then youll definitely have a great time with the show. The running gags are funny Mashs hamstring magic and whatever other bullshit he creates is entertaining to watch and theres a certain bliss in just how lightheartedly the show takes itself. In terms of the action its pretty decent. You wont find brilliant streaks of sakuga here but the fights are generally wellcoordinated and interesting and I especially enjoyed the fights at the latter end of the season. The powers are interesting if not unique and theres some really great moments of strategy and dialogue which I sometimes find missing in other Shonen. Moreover the antagonists while not necessarily deep are highly enjoyable and I love their character designs which makes them a delight whenever they appear. When it comes to what makes the show so great its hard to say. None of the elements Characters Plot Action Comedy are especially standout but they are all generally good and thats what counts The consistency of Mashle leads to its brilliance. Ive heard a lot of people dislike the first couple episodes for being boring without much action but I think its important to remember Mashle is first and foremost a parody show and you should focus primarily on the initial comedy to see if its worth your time or not. Overall Mashle is not a deep show by any means at least yet. But what it is is cheesy lighthearted comedic fun with a side of entertaining action In the anime community it seems like that kind of lighthearted fun is often brushed off as entertaining but meh compared to more thoughtprovoking philosophical shows or feats of beautifully choreographed and animated fight scenes but to me I think shows like this which are perfect to unwind to and enjoy when stressed out are essential and worthy of praise.
